Spybot - Search & Destroy 1.2
CWShredder Both those programs have update features so make sure you update them before scanning with them...every time you use them. CWShredder is simple...update check then click "Fix" Spybot has a wee-bit more to it, update check then click "Search & Destroy" (top left) then click "Check for problems" (bottom left). When it's done scanning bad stuff will already be checkmarked so all you have to do is click "Fix selected problems". |
